“…Tritiated water (HTO) effects were studied at dose rates of 3.4x10 1 , 1.36x10 2 and 1.26x10 3 µGy/h until larvae reached 10 dpf (days post fertilization), in order to observe a key phase of larval development until the total resorption of yolk bag, and therefore to investigate potential effects on metabolism (Gagnaire et al 2020a). The links between responses observed at the molecular, tissular and individual levels were also investigated using specific tools such as RNAseq (Arcanjo et al 2018) and behavioral analyses (Arcanjo et al 2020). Tritiated thymidine was also studied at dose rates of 8.7x10 1 to 2.4x10 3 µGy/h (Adam-Guillermin et al 2013).…”

“…Arcanjo et al . [23, 24] exposed zebrafish eggs at two HTO concentrations corresponding to dose-rates of 0.4 mGy/h and 4 mGy/h, and investigated the effect on the transcriptome [ 23 , 24 ]. They reported that the genes involved in DNA repair such as h2afx , bcl2l and xrcc1 were upregulated when eggs were irradiated at 4 mGy/h, whereas the genes involved in promoting apoptosis were upregulated when eggs were irradiated at 0.4 mGy/h.…”

“…The fate of tritium, an isotope of hydrogen (half-life 12.3 y), in the human body, as tritiated water (HTO) or organically bound tritium (OBT), is well understood, with inhaled HTO translocated quickly into blood and distributed uniformly (Di Pace et al, 2008;Nie et al, 2021). Furthermore, tritium-induced biological effects have been extensively explored in aquatic biota under a range of radiation dose rates (Jha et al, 2005(Jha et al, , 2006Adam-Guillermin et al, 2012;Jaeschke and Bradshaw, 2013;Dallas et al, 2016a,b;Gagnaire et al, 2017;Festarini et al, 2019;Arcanjo et al, 2020). However, there is a gap in understanding related to the environmental fate and subsequent radiotoxicity of tritiated products.…”
